RE: What did everyone cook today?
I cooked/Fried for 120 people this past weekend. I was way too busy to take photos. The menu, Atlantic Cod, hush puppies both corn only and with jolopino’s. Fires, corn on the cob, and a 130 year old recipe for a vinegar base slaw. (That everyone wants) lol. Not going to get it.
I used middle of the road oil for frying, no complaints.
My fryer is a cajon cooker 8.5 gallon. No burning of food particles in the bottom half. I did filter the oil after with out any off putting odors.
My question, after that menu, heavy with fish, what can I fry in this again? -
